    The Joshua Foundation is a charity created in 1998 to provide holidays and experiences for children and their families, where the child is diagnosed with terminal cancer. The Joshua Foundation (TJF) is a Cardiff based national charity that was created in September 1998 to provide holidays and experiences for children with terminal cancer and their families where the child is aged between birth and 19. The Joshua Foundation was launched on September 27th 1998 with a 5k fun run/walk that raised…
